- Home
- Categorie
- Coding e Sistemistica
- CMS & Piattaforme Self-Hosted
- Errore database in remoto
-
Errore database in remoto
Allora vi espongo il mio grosso problema.
In locale joomla mi va perfetto, funziona tutto. utilizzo Xampp, mySql 5.0.51a, PhpMyAdmin 2.9.2
In remoto (Ho hosting linux con aruba) ho MySQL 4.0.27-standard-log, PhpMyAdmin 2.11.5
Quando vado a caricare il database mi esce questo errore
Vi prego aiutatemi
phpMyAdmin SQL Dump
-- version 2.9.2--
-- Host: localhost
-- Generato il: 18 Mar, 2008 at 11:55 AM
-- Versione MySQL: 5.0.51
-- Versione PHP: 5.2.5-- Database:
joomla
--
-- Struttura della tabellajos_bannerCREATE TABLE
jos_banner(
bidint( 11 ) NOT NULL AUTO_INCREMENT ,
cidint( 11 ) NOT NULL default '0',
typevarchar( 10 ) COLLATE latin1_general_ci NOT NULL default 'banner',
namevarchar( 50 ) COLLATE latin1_general_ci NOT NULL default '',
imptotalint( 11 ) NOT NULL default '0',
impmadeint( 11 ) NOT NULL default '0',
clicksint( 11 ) NOT NULL default '0',
imageurlvarchar( 100 ) COLLATE latin1_general_ci NOT NULL default '',
clickurlvarchar( 200 ) COLLATE latin1_general_ci NOT NULL default '',
datedatetime default NULL ,
showBannertinyint( 1 ) NOT NULL default '0',
checked_outtinyint( 1 ) NOT NULL default '0',
checked_out_timedatetime NOT NULL default '0000-00-00 00:00:00',
editorvarchar( 50 ) COLLATE latin1_general_ci default NULL ,
custombannercodetext COLLATE latin1_general_ci,
PRIMARY KEY (bid) ,
KEYviewbanner(showBanner)
) ENGINE = MYISAM DEFAULT CHARSET = latin1 COLLATE = latin1_general_ci AUTO_INCREMENT =3;Messaggio di MySQL:
#1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'collate latin1_general_ci NOT NULL default 'banner',
namev
-
Prova a togliere "collate latin1_general_ci ..." dalle querry.
-
Tutto ok!! O quasi...
Mi mancano solo le tabelle della Zoom Gallery!
Ecco il messaggio di errore:
CREATE TABLE
jos_zoom_comments(
cmtidint( 11 ) NOT NULL AUTO_INCREMENT ,
imgidint( 11 ) NOT NULL default '0',
cmtnamevarchar( 40 ) NOT NULL default '',
cmtcontenttext NOT NULL ,
cmtdatetimestamp NOT NULL default C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P ,
PRIMARY KEY (cmtid) ,
KEYimgid(imgid)
) ENGINE = MYISAM ;**Messaggio di MySQL: **
#1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'CURRENT_TIMESTAMP on update CURRENT_TIMESTAMP,
PRIMARY KEY
-
Prova a togliere CURRENT_TIMESTAMP on update CURRENT_TIMESTAMP.
ciao